June 21 - Nepal Independent Domestic Workers Union (NIDWU) along with GEFONT submitted the Memorandum to the Ministry of Labour and Employment for the ratification of ILO convention No. 189. GEFONT NEC member Cde. Maiya Pode, Cde. Sonu Danuwar president of NIDWU Chair, Cde. Shushila Chaulagaivice-president NIDWU, Cde. Rohini Pd. Dahal; General Secretary, NIDWU and Cde. Bechan Mahato, Education Secretary NIDWU handed over the memorandum to the Joint Secretary Mr. Nabin Pokhrel.
Hand overing the Memorandum, Cde. Sonu Danuwar briefed about the situation of domestic workers and demanded for the ratification of the convention in order to secure domestic workers right. The demands include:Registration of Domestic Workers at the local authority, social security for all the domestic workers, to establish the embassy or labour attaché in gulf state and establish Women unit in the Department of Foreign Employment for Decent and safe foreign employment
